Financial Analyst Full Description

POSITION RESPONSIBILITIES: 
  • Budget analysis on Renovation and Plant Fund projects (budget vs. actual costs). Update all Renovation, Grant & Plant Fund project spreadsheets to new commitments/actual and monitor expenditures for budget compliance
  • Prepare Plant Fund, Grant & Renovation reports - providing status of each individual project, detailing budget, commitment & actual
  • Monthly G/L analysis of all OTPS and Plant Fund accounts
  • Analyze & report variances on overtime expenditures, monitoring performance by comparing Payroll's OT Differential Report vs. the Work Order Management System OT vs approved OT requests
  • Issue Long Range (20 year) Capital Plan. This includes maintaining & developing the database, editing & adding new capital projects and preparing reports for senior management. Projecting capital improvement costs over a 20 year period, totaling approximately $80 million
  • Support the Assistant Director with annual & mid-year budget preparation, including analysis of current expenditures for fiscal year end and proposed expenditures for the next fiscal year
  • Create requisitions and work with Procurement, Safety and Vendor for processing.
  • Generate reports from CMS (Workorder system) to facilitate billing for departmental chargebacks.
  • Other related duties as assigned. 

*This position requires working entirely on-site, with no remote options.

* QUALIFICATIONS: 
  • Bachelor's degree in a Business related discipline and 2-3 years of related experience is required
  • High level skill with Microsoft Excel, Microsoft Word, Microsoft Powerpoint.  Knowledge of Banner Software a plus.
  • Experience with budget management/monitoring
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Develops effective relationships with peers, students and employees
  • Assumes responsibility to ensure issues/concerns will be addressed and monitors them through conclusion
  • Identifies, defines and analyzes information and situations before recommending a course of action
  • Effectively manages own time and resources
  • Seeks to apply technology and innovation to improve efficiency and solve problems
